Real-World Fuel Efficiency That Keeps Costs Low
Efficiency is a standout strength among the best small cars. Expect combined figures of 32-36 mpg from popular gas models like the Honda Civic, Kia K4, and Hyundai Elantra, with real-world results often matching or beating EPA estimates. Hybrid variants, such as the Toyota Corolla Hybrid, push numbers toward 50 mpg combined, dramatically cutting fuel bills.

Trim Levels, Pricing, and Smart Value
Pricing for the best small cars remains approachable in 2026. The Kia K4 starts around $23,500, the Honda Civic near $24,695, the Hyundai Elantra from about $23,870, and the Toyota Corolla in a similar budget-friendly range. Base trims cover essentials well, while mid-level options add desirable upgrades like alloy wheels, premium audio, and enhanced driver aids without pushing past $30,000 in most cases.
Many buyers find the middle trims strike the perfect balance of features and cost. Strong resale value further enhances the overall value proposition, especially for well-regarded models from established brands.
Pros and Cons of 2026 Best Small Cars
Pros:
- Excellent maneuverability and easy parking in tight spaces
- Strong fuel economy that lowers daily driving costs
- Spacious and cleverly designed interiors for their size
- Comprehensive safety features and proven reliability
- Affordable pricing with good long-term value retention
Cons:
- Limited cargo space compared to midsize sedans or SUVs
- Base engines can feel adequate rather than powerful on highways
- Some models offer less rear headroom for taller passengers
- Fewer luxury-like refinements than higher-priced segments
